Transaction 0593ce71bc76e7ceecfda6e89d29a1b45b61345ac0c9fe17e55e92b5d88e696d

1 Input
2 Outputs
  • 0593ce71bc76e7ceecfda6e89d29a1b45b61345ac0c9fe17e55e92b5d88e696d:0
  • value  20712539
    address  1JwbXTYVx3AqDUna1jrVBgPYpcvLA8TSRP
  • 0593ce71bc76e7ceecfda6e89d29a1b45b61345ac0c9fe17e55e92b5d88e696d:1
  • value  3244228
    address  13Bq6SJghzbm5ykaw6imU7gWejA4FNMMLX